    Head restraint - Wikipedia

    Head restraints (also called headrests) are an automotive safety feature, attached or integrated into the top of each seat to limit the rearward movement of the adult occupant's head, relative to the torso, in a collision — to prevent or mitigate whiplash or injury to the cervical vertebrae.     Headrests are actually head restraints, designed as a safety feature to help protect both the drivers and passenger (s) from injury should the vehicle be involved in a collision. To help minimize the risk of neck injury in the event of a crash, the head restraint must be adjusted properly.
